How To Use The Prompt Assistant

We have just launched a new category, called the Prompt Assistant! We have a SFW version, and 18+ version (you need access to the Lemon Bar to be able to view it); and this guide is about its features, and how to include your own prompts!

The Prompt Assistant tool was designed to help you get your creative juices flowing! We have a Prompt Calendar, a Prompt Generator, and several prefilled groups of prompts to get you started, but we would also love for you to contribute your own prompt ideas to help make the Prompt Assistants even more fun to use!

Prompt Calendar

The Prompt Calendar contains a list of real holidays and observances across the globe that you can create for! We’ve included a handful of our own dates, as well as some fun international ones (eg. New Year, Ramen Day), but we don’t have, or know, every single date in the world, so we encourage you to add your own!

Prompt Generator

Our clever mod @oneinist created a SFW Prompt Generator using the prompts that have been listed in the Prompt Assistant! If you’d like to have a greater selection of prompts in the generator, please continue to fill the Prompt Assistant, so we can add more in!

Adding Prompts

If you want to add prompts to an existing group of prompts, just reply to the thread with your list of new ideas!

Adding a New Group of Prompts

If you’re inspired to add a new group of prompts, this is how to do it:

SFW Prompt Assistant

  1. Create a new topic.

  2. In the Title, type out the category (eg. Found Family, Fluff)

  3. In the body of the message, type out a little About, and then post your message. You can use this template:

You can find & share [insert group here] prompts here!

  1. Reply to your post with your prompt ideas!

18+ Prompt Assistant

  1. Create a new topic.

  2. In the Title, type out the category. If there are DARK prompts, or it is created for DARK prompts, you must put (CW: dark prompts) in the title.

  3. In the body of the message, type out a little About, and then post your message. If there are DARK prompts, or it is created for DARK prompts, you must put a warning in your About! You can use this template:

You can find & share [insert group here] prompts here!

CW: This thread contains DARK prompts, and could potentially include words/ topics that might be triggers for you. Proceed at your own risk!

  1. Reply to your post with your prompt ideas!
